A manually configured dynamic MAC address entry has the same priority as an automatically
learned one. If a packet with such a source MAC address enters the device on a different interface
from that in the static MAC address entry, the device learns a new MAC address entry and uses the
learned one to overwrite the manually configured dynamic MAC address entry.
When you configure a dynamic MAC address entry, if an automatically learned MAC address
entry with the same MAC address but a different outgoing interface already exists in the MAC
address table, the manually configured entry overwrites the automatically learned MAC address
entry.
The manually configured static, blackhole, and multiport unicast MAC address entries cannot
survive a reboot if you do not save the configuration. The manually configured dynamic MAC
address entries, however, are lost upon reboot whether or not you save the configuration.
Configuration procedure
To add or modify a static or dynamic MAC address entry globally:
Step Command Remarks
1. Enter system view.
system-view N/A
2. Add or modify a
MAC address
entry.
mac-address { dynamic | static } mac-address
interface interface-type interface-number vlan
vlan-id
By default, no MAC address
entry is configured globally.
Make sure you have created
the VLAN and assigned the
interface to the VLAN.
